一、弹性扩展的核心机制
阿里弹性云服务器通过弹性伸缩组实现资源的动态调整,该机制包含三大核心组件:
- 伸缩规则:定义CPU利用率、内存阈值等触发条件
- 实例模板:预设扩容时使用的ECS配置参数
- 健康检查:自动替换异常实例保障服务连续性
系统通过云监控实时采集指标数据,当检测到预设阈值被触发时,自动执行扩容/缩容操作,整个过程可在5分钟内完成。
二、配置弹性扩展的步骤
- 登录控制台创建伸缩组,设置实例数量上下限
- 定义伸缩配置:选择实例规格、镜像和安全组
- 创建报警任务:设置CPU>80%触发扩容等规则
- 集成负载均衡:自动将新实例加入SLB集群
参数类型 | 建议值 |
---|---|
冷却时间 | 300秒 |
扩容步长 | 每次增加2实例 |
三、典型应用场景
该技术特别适用于:
- 电商促销期间的流量峰值应对
- 大数据处理的批量计算任务
- 游戏服务器的在线人数波动
某电商企业通过该方案在双十一期间自动扩容200%计算资源,成本节约达40%。
四、最佳实践与注意事项
实施弹性扩展时应遵循:
- 设置合理的监控指标采样频率(建议1分钟)
- 预留20%的缓冲容量应对突发流量
- 定期审查伸缩日志优化触发阈值
需避免在业务高峰期执行系统更新,同时要确保应用具备横向扩展能力。
阿里弹性云服务器的自动化扩展机制通过智能资源调度与精细化策略配置,实现了计算资源的动态优化。结合云监控和弹性伸缩组,企业可构建高可用、高弹性的云架构,有效平衡性能需求与运维成本。